How did we get stuck with the boring toothbrush?

When traveling, you discover that there are thousand of new ways to do those tasks you only imagined done in a particular way. When this happens you remember how fixed your own way of doing things and how less creative you become just because you do not feel the need of changing. That is what I felt last time I went to a store in Tokyo and I found a 2 meters long display with all kind of unimaginable toothbrushes and dental cleaning products that I have never seen before.

Thinking about this, I started to wonder how many of the things we use everyday could be improved and I remembered the Ideo interview, when designing that shopping cart and they said "Someone designed everything around you, from your toothbrush to your home town"... in that moment I really felt the meaning of those words..

It is also important to remember that everything you do as a temporary solution will stay unchanged and you will forget why it was temporary, blending gradually with the context and becoming permanent. It is not until you challenge the everyday concepts that you realize things can be done in a better way.
